| ⇢ | A | SlicedIterator added | |
| ⇢ | A | Grammar added | |
| ⇢ | A | Builder added | |
| ⇢ | A | ConcatenationBuilder added | |
| ⇢ | A | TokenBuilder added | |
| ⇢ | A | RulesBuilder added | |
| ⇢ | A | Result added | |
| ⇢ | A | Runtime added | |
| A | ↛ | LookaheadIterator removed | |
| A | ↛ | ParsingResult removed | |
| A | ↛ | Parser removed |
| ⇢ | B | RulesBuilder::build() added | |
| ⇢ | A | Grammar::getState() added | |
| ⇢ | A | RuleResolver::resolveDelegate() added | |
| ⇢ | A | RulesBuilder::__construct() added | |
| ⇢ | A | Result::__construct() added | |
| ⇢ | A | Grammar::__construct() added | |
| ⇢ | A | RulesBuilder::add() added | |
| ⇢ | A | Builder::__construct() added | |
| ⇢ | A | RulesBuilder::getId() added | |
| ⇢ | A | SlicedIterator::getOuterIterator() added | |
| ⋮ | view more | ||
| B | ↗ | A | RuleResolver::resolveCurrent() improved |
| A | ↛ | Parser::getState() removed | |
| A | ↛ | ParsingResult::getLexer() removed | |
| A | ↛ | Parser::__construct() removed | |
| A | ↛ | ParsingResult::__construct() removed | |
| A | ↛ | ParsingResult::getParser() removed | |
| A | ↛ | ParsingResult::getRules() removed | |
| A | ↛ | ParsingResult::getBuilders() removed | |
| A | ↛ | LookaheadIterator::rewind() removed | |
| A | ↛ | LookaheadIterator::next() removed | |
| A | ↛ | Parser::process() removed | |
| ⋮ | view more | ||